What is the difference between the Thumbport and Thumbport II?

0

The Thumbport II has a lower default angle for the thumb. It’s a little thicker and more rigid. It touches the flute tube less. And, its extension arm is a little shorter (when attached to the flute, it may go into the case easier for some). Also the end of the extension has a more rounded shape. If the default angle on the Thumbport II (when the back top end pushes against the flute rib) is too low, one can use a blade to cut the end off a little. This way the angle can be modified. Adding isn’t as easy as removing; that is the reason why the new shell is longer. Some players still prefers the older design. The Thumbport II won’t replace the older version. To Top.
